Day 2: FULL DAY TOUR TO ANGKOR TEMPLES
After relishing on scrumptious breakfast at the hotel, head out to visit the ancient city of Angkor Thom. This city, which is surroundedby an 8m high wall,was the last capital of the Great Khmer Empire.
Later continue to Ta Prohm Temple, which is full of natural beauty. This photogenic place is unlike most other Angkor temples. The sight of trees growing out of the temple ruins makes it one of Angkor's most popular temples.
In the afternoon, visit the great Angkor Wat, a temple dedicated to the Hindu god Vishnu. This temple was built by King Suryavarman II, who reigned from1131 to 1150. It took over 30 years to build this temple.
The most interesting thing about Angkor Wat, Cambodia is that it features the longest continuous bas-relief in the world, which runs along the outer gallery walls and depicts stories from Hindu mythology. In 1992, the UNESCO declared Angkor Wat as a World Heritage Site.

Day 5: PHNOM PENH FULL DAY CITY TOUR
Gain insight into Cambodia’s contrasting history by visiting the remarkable Tuol Sleng Genocide Museum. This museum is housed in the former school that was taken over by the Khmer Rouge. It was used as its main detention and torture centre named ‘S-21’.
In the afternoon, visit the National Museum and understand Angkorian history. Explore the famous Royal Palace, built in 1866 under the French protectorate and King Norodom. Just adjoining the palace is a Silver Pagoda, famous for its intricate decorations, silver paved floors and precious metals and stones studded Buddha statues.
Set out to explore another attraction – Wat Phnom temple, the birthplace of Phnom Penh. This temple is set on the top of a tree-covered hill.
